    I couponed for less than half of this year, but I got some great deals. I want to be even more dedicated to stockpiling and saving in 2011. Some of my goals are:
    • Take advantage of more rebate offers.
    • Take advantage of more Target gift card offers.
    • Have most of Christmas shopping done by the end of summer.
    • Stockpile more paper products and food items.
    • Only buy items I have more than a year's supply of if they are free, MM, fillers, or needed to roll ECBs.
    • Do more coupon trades on HCW.
    • Enter more contests.
    • Write more companies for coupons and samples.
    • Inventory and photograph stockpile for insurance purposes.
    • Mail care packages to family members every other month.
    • Budget $10 per week for Black Friday and after Christmas sales.

    What are your couponing and stockpiling goals for 2011?

    My goals for 2011:

    Organize stockpile.
    Rotate stock so I don't find items shoved to the back that are out-of-date.
    Don't buy more than we can use or give away even if it is cheap or free.
    Continue to do rebates.
    Do a better job of organizing coupons.
    Write companies to get coupons.
    Do more try-me-frees...only out the cost of a stamp.

    Wow...I haven't put much thought into this...I started in 2007 and this year is the first year where I really feel like I have a great system! I tracked everything I spent on consumables (except eating out) from 1/1 to 6/30 and I had made close to $400 profit after rebates. I didn't track the second half because I got tired:) Rebates received in 2010 amount to $1366 with another $228 pending and probably $100ish in my envie waiting for me to get them in the mail.

    I would say my goals are:

    1. Learn how to cook more things so I can take advantage of more deals.
    2. Eat out less - although we have significantly reduced it this year. My love of sushi is great though and can't make it:(
    3. Work harder looking for non grocery/drug store deals. (i.e. toys, movies, etc. I got a taste for it when I got my kids their leap tag books free this year). I want to expand beyond consumables!
    4. Stockpile a diaper/formula supply for baby #3 - we just went off birth control:)
    5. Slow down a bit with normal stockpiling so I don't burn out! I don't need to chase every deal; I have a great stockpile and can wait for the easier deals to come along for most items. Now convincing myself of this when I see the sales ad and have coupons in hand is another story!
